German battery forum discussions note that while the cell can theoretically handle 30 A discharge currents, the usable energy drops significantly when discharged at higher rates, particularly if the cut‑off voltage is set above 3.0 V. In other words, the cell is high‑capacity but not truly high‑power; pushing it beyond its rated continuous current will result in diminished performance and potentially reduced service life.
